This space was attended by 15 multi-sector companies from Bogota, which had the opportunity to establish strategic connections and explore new markets.
During the event, the companies made a total of 150 business appointments, which generated sales projections for USD 5.1 million.
María Mónica Conde, Vice President of International Relations of the CCB, emphasized that: “This mission reaffirms our commitment to the international projection of Bogota and the strengthening of business relations in Latin America. We hope to continue strengthening strategic ties and opening new opportunities for the internationalization of our companies”.
One of the participating businessmen, Daniel Barón Luque, Operations Director of Laboratorio Industrial Andino, expressed his gratitude: “I thank the Chamber of Commerce for this work, for the experience and the learning we had during the mission to see the viability of our products in these two countries”.
Valeria Maldonado Ramírez, commercial director of Setas Doradas, said: “During the mission, we had the opportunity to learn how the market works and which are the leading chains. We hope to continue to count on the support of our commercial ally, the Bogotá Chamber of Commerce”.
This type of initiative underscores the CCB's commitment to support the diversification of markets for companies in Bogotá and Cundinamarca, providing the tools and spaces needed to expand their presence in international markets.
